Get in Touch** The Subaru repair market in and around Elkhorn, Nebraska, is robust and reflects the brand's strong popularity in the region. The market is characterized by a clear dichotomy between the authorized dealership and high-quality independent specialists. * **Average Quality & Competition:** The average quality of Subaru service is high. Competition is strong between the dealership (Baxter Subaru) and a handful of well-established independent shops (like The Import Specialists and O'Meara Japanese Auto). This competition benefits consumers by driving a focus on customer service and technical excellence. * **Typical Pricing:** A clear pricing tier exists. The dealership (Baxter) typically commands the highest labor rates, justified by their direct access to Subaru technical resources, specialized equipment for advanced systems like EyeSight, and genuine parts. The independent specialists generally offer labor rates 15-30% lower, making them a highly attractive option for out-of-warranty repairs, especially for major mechanical work like head gaskets and engine rebuilds. * **Specialization:** For routine maintenance and minor repairs, all three providers are excellent. However, for specific needs, the choice becomes clear: independents for major mechanical work and the dealership for advanced electronics, calibrations, and warranty service. The presence of these highly-rated independents so close to Elkhorn provides Subaru owners with meaningful choice and value without sacrificing expertise.

In Elkhorn, common Subaru issues include head gasket failures on older models (like the Outback and Forester), CVT transmission service needs, and wheel bearing wear. The local climate, with its hot summers and road treatments in winter, can accelerate these wear items, making regular inspections important.
Look for an independent shop that is Subaru-specific or Asian-import focused, with technicians certified by the Subaru FAST program. Check reviews for Elkhorn-area shops that mention consistent communication, proper diagnosis, and use of quality OEM or equivalent parts for long-term reliability.
Have the AWD system and differential fluids checked if you notice binding during tight turns, hear unusual noises, or before and after severe Nebraska weather seasons. Proactive service is key, especially if you frequently drive on gravel country roads or through Omaha's winter conditions.
Subaru repair costs can be slightly higher due to specialized AWD components and boxer engines, but a reputable local independent shop often provides significant savings over the dealership. Always request a detailed written estimate specific to your model's common issues to understand the pricing.
Given Nebraska's temperature extremes, pay special attention to your cooling system and battery health. Also, frequent travel on I-80 and seasonal potholes mean alignments and suspension checks are crucial to prevent uneven tire wear, a common issue on Subarus.
